I Gave My Mafia Fiancé to My Evil Stepsister Chapter 1

The first thing I did when I came back to life was to pawn off my engagement to the Don of the Schroder family, Edmund, on my stepsister.

In my last life, he used the "family rules" to make me give up the one thing I loved—racing. He threw out all my colorful dresses and turned me into his canary in a gilded cage.

I died, suffocated and hopeless.

When I opened my eyes again, I was back on the day the marriage contract was to be signed.

I quietly switched my name with my stepsister Laura's and let Edmund sign the papers.

He didn't forget to warn me, "Stay out of trouble. Our wedding is in three days. Be a good girl and wait for me to come get you."

But he had no idea I'd already bought a fake ID and passport.

In three days, I'd be gone. I'd be free.

I died on a bloody night.

A bullet from a rival family tore through my chest. I collapsed in a cold, abandoned warehouse, my vision blurring.

The last thing I saw was Edmund, running towards me.

He fell to his knees beside me, his cold, gray eyes—usually so hard—shining with tears. His hands trembled as he pressed down on my wound, but blood seeped through his fingers.

"Alessia... don't close your eyes. Look at me..." His voice shook.

I wanted to tell him that if he had just let me go, if he hadn't trapped me with those damn "family rules," maybe I wouldn't be dying here.

But when I tried to speak, only blood bubbled from my lips.

Darkness swallowed everything.

When I opened my eyes again, I saw the familiar pink velvet curtains and crystal chandelier.

I shot up in bed and looked at the calendar on my nightstand: three years ago, to the day.

I was reborn.

Back to the day the marriage contract was to be signed. Back to the beginning of my nightmare.

I didn't waste a second. I bolted down the stairs and threw open the door to my father's study.

"I'm calling off the engagement."

The room went dead silent. My father’s teacup froze mid-air. My stepmother, Claire, stared with wide eyes.

"What did you say?" My father slammed his cup on the table. "You think this is a game? This is the Schroder family! Do you have any idea how many girls would kill to be in your place?"

"Then give it to someone who wants it. Like Laura," I said calmly.

The anger on my father's face froze. Claire snapped out of her shock, so excited she almost jumped out of her chair.

"Are you... are you serious?" my father stammered.

I knew exactly what they were thinking. My father always favored the quiet, obedient Laura, and Claire had always dreamed of her daughter marrying into a powerful family.

"Of course, I'm serious. Laura's always wanted this, hasn't she? She can have it," I said with a shrug. That was all I came to say. I turned to leave.

"I'm calling Mrs. Schroder right now!" my father said, grabbing the phone with glee.

Back in my room, I took out the marriage contract and changed "Alessia" to "Laura." Then, papers in hand, I drove straight to Edmund's office.

Edmund looked surprised to see me. I always complained his office was nothing but black and white, a boring place I never wanted to set foot in.

He glanced at his watch. "You're early. I thought we agreed on three o'clock."

I forced a smile. "I... I couldn't wait to see you."

A faint smile touched his lips.

He took the contract. The terms were already set, so he signed it without a second look. The moment his pen left the paper, a massive weight lifted off my chest.

"Good," he said, pleased with my eagerness. "Our wedding is in three days. Be a good girl and wait for me to come marry you."

"I will," I nodded sweetly, but inside, I was laughing my head off.

The second I left, I dialed an encrypted number.

"I need a new identity. A passport, too."

"Three days. Usual place," a low, gravelly voice answered.

After hanging up, I straightened my hair in a storefront window. The girl in the reflection had a fire in her eyes I'd never seen before.

Freedom. My freedom was finally within reach.

That night, I met my best friend Chloe at the wildest club downtown to celebrate. The music was deafening, the neon lights blinding, and the air thick with the smell of alcohol and freedom. It was exactly the kind of place Edmund hated.

"Alessia, are you sure you should be here?" Chloe asked, worried. "If Edmund finds out—"

"He won't be my fiancé for much longer," I said, leaning back on the leather sofa and sipping a Bloody Mary. "Relax, I've got this."

A young, handsome bartender came over to mix us new drinks. His movements were smooth, his features as perfect as a Greek statue. High on my newfound freedom, I reached out and gently stroked his chin.

"You're a pretty one, aren't you?"

Just then, a cold, deep voice—laced with the scent of blood and steel—came from behind me.

"Who's pretty?"
